Simon Burgener is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Materials Chemistry.
According to data from OpenAlex, Simon Burgener has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 682 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 3 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Simon Burgener’s work include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(7 papers), Enzyme Immobilization Techniques (4 papers) and Biochemical Acid Research Studies (3 papers). Simon Burgener is often cited by papers focused on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(7 papers), Enzyme Immobilization Techniques (4 papers) and Biochemical Acid Research Studies (3 papers). Simon Burgener coll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and The Netherlands. Simon Burgener's co-authors include Tobias J. Erb, Arren Bar‐Even, Nicole Paczia, Luca Schulz and Thomas Schwander and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Nature Communications.
